Senior Software Engineer
7 months ago
Senior Software Engineer
Sydney, Australia
Description
is the world's largest freelancing and crowdsourcing marketplace in the world, with over 60 million freelancers across the globe. Our marketplace hosts a real life economy, where work is undertaken in every area you can think of. From design, writing, data entry and software development; through to cleaning, plumbing and dog walking - even NASA uses us
This won't be your typical cog-in-the-machine type of job. If you're a high achiever with talent, looking for something more than a boring job in corporate, want to work with the best and brightest and don't need to be handheld, this is the job for you.
If you join a mega-cap technology company as the 10,000th hire you might struggle to figure out the impact you are making. If you join a startup, you might get to work on the latest fad, but likely have few mentors to learn from, work on toy problems and never change the world.
At Freelancer you’ll get to work on a highly diverse, global set of internet-scale challenges where you will make a meaningful difference with real responsibility, while rapidly building your skills. We run a meritocracy - we actively promote from within.
You’ll also change lives - our mission is to provide one billion jobs. Not many companies actually make a difference like Freelancer does in providing opportunity and income to people all around the world.
We have a very wide range of engineering challenges to sink your teeth into. You’ll get a chance to be exposed to a wide variety of technologies across our businesses. is an Alexa top 1000 website with a cutting-edge frontend stack incorporating Angular, TypeScript and RxJS. Our backend powers a large suite of services running a modern global marketplace; messaging, payments, translations, file services and a notification system sending millions of notifications an hour. We deploy code to production multiple times a day.
Our companies include:
- a global payments system for large ticket items with over $5 billion USD transactions secured.
Loadshift - a global heavy haulage freight marketplace.
Photo Anywhere - give us a location, we'll send you photos in 24-48 hours.
Warrior Forum - the #1 internet market community since 1997.
So you think you have what it takes to be an Engineer at Freelancer?
We are looking for fullstack senior software engineers. Our team work with the latest tech, and push code 30-40 times a day in a high-performance cloud environment. We develop core, revenue-generating products, and so this represents an opportunity to have a fundamental impact on our global business.
Not only will you build features and software that scale, but your work will have direct impact on tens of millions of users worldwide. You would be architecting web applications at scale, enjoying the challenge of writing optimised lightning fast SQL for massive data sets, you will be structuring extensible data and application logic, and be passionate about designing high quality APIs.
Our advanced Angular codebase runs in the browser for desktop and mobile devices, runs on the server to deliver fast, server-side rendered pages for SEO, and inside our iOS and Android mobile apps, all tested with cutting edge automated test suites.
Requirements
Musts haves:
Proficiency in a few web development languages, such as Python, Golang, PHP, or Ruby Experience with relational databases and SQL, preferably MySQL Background or interest in web engineering at scale Experience working in an agile team environment, continuously shipping environment Linux experience Cloud computing experience, preferably AWS Strong writing and verbal communication skills Strong sense of ownership and able to self-manage work Self-motivated and tracked-record of learning new technologies Strong troubleshooting skills and creative problem-solving ability Experience with designing and implementing complex software systems Experience with mentoring/training junior engineersNice-to-haves:
Experience with SOA, microservice and containerisation architecture Experience with development of public facing APIs Experience with modern Javascript framework, such as Angular, React or Vue Experience with TypeScript Strong knowledge of computer networking Sound understanding of OWASP and the best web security practicesWe would love you to have:
Strong academic achievements MS or PhD degrees A Github page with contributions to open source software Experience with leading an engineering teamBenefits
A meritocratic culture with the ability to take ownership and fast track your career growth. You will be working on an Alexa top ranked website, solving complex, internet scale and global challenges in systems engineering with over 60 million customers across 247 countries, regions & territories. Weekly Town Halls with the all important Q&A session with the CEO (you really can ask him anything) Free Class Pass membership. Friday lunches - We finish each week with a catered lunch. Every Friday we offer a different cuisine from local restaurants. Fully stocked kitchens + yes we do have beer taps (and a bar with a killer view) Hack-a-thons - Get hacking and programming in this quarterly company-wide where teams create solutions to existing problems and win prizes. The 2-day event is filled with games, events, shows, food and more. Fun events (we once built a soccer stadium in the office with two tonnes of turf). Located at Grosvenor Place - Home of Freelancer HQ, this iconic building and location with harbour views with weekly and complimentary classes, activities, events, promotions, competitions and dealsJust when you thought it couldn’t get any better:
Change lives every day – Everything we do as part of our jobs contribute to improving the lives of our users on a global scale. Fast-track your career - We boast a meritocratic culture, renowned for hiring into senior roles from within and producing many business and product leaders in the technology industry-
Sr. Software Engineer
7 months ago
Sydney, Australia Dew Software Full timeDew Software, a leading player in the digital transformation space, is seeking a highly skilled Sr. Software Engineer to join our team. As a Fortune 500 collaborator, we take pride in our commitment to quality and excellence. We operate from 14 development centers in 9 countries, giving our team members access to diverse talent and expertise from around the...
-
Senior Software Engineering Lead
4 weeks ago
Sydney, New South Wales, Australia Commonwealth Bank of Australia Full timeTransforming the Banking Experience as a Senior Software Engineer at Commonwealth Bank of AustraliaWe are seeking an experienced and skilled Senior Software Engineer to join our team at the Commonwealth Bank of Australia.Salary: $120,000 - $180,000 per annum, depending on experience and qualifications.About Us:The Commonwealth Bank of Australia is a leading...
-
Senior Software Engineer
1 month ago
Sydney, Australia WiseTech Global Full timeWe're seeking skilled and experienced mid/senior/lead level Software Engineers. Fluency in one or more of the following languages—Thai, Filipino, Malay, or Indonesian—is essential. The role can be based in Sydney (HQ), Melbourne, or Adelaide.
-
Senior Software Engineer
2 months ago
Sydney, New South Wales, Australia Hospoworld Resourcing Full timeAbout the Role:We are seeking a highly skilled Senior Software Engineer to join our team at {company}.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software solutions using...
-
Senior Software Engineer
7 months ago
Sydney, Australia Anduril Full timeAnduril Industries is a defense technology company with a mission to transform U.S. and allied military capabilities with advanced technology. By bringing the expertise, technology, and business model of the 21st century’s most innovative companies to the defense industry, Anduril is changing how military systems are designed, built and sold. Anduril’s...
-
Senior Software Developer
1 month ago
Sydney, New South Wales, Australia LEAP Legal Software Full timeAt LEAP Legal Software, we are currently seeking a skilled Software Engineer to join our team. As a key member of our Engineering team, you will collaborate closely with our founder to gain a deep understanding of our product's technical landscape. In the long term, you will play a vital role in enhancing LawTap's functionality and oversee all aspects of...
-
Senior Software Engineer
2 weeks ago
Sydney, New South Wales, Australia Reward Gateway Full timeJob Summary:We are seeking an experienced Senior Software Engineer to join our team at Reward Gateway. As a key member of our software development team, you will play a critical role in designing, developing, and testing software applications.The ideal candidate will have a strong background in software development, with experience in programming languages...
-
Senior Software Engineer
5 months ago
Sydney, Australia Anduril Full timeAnduril Industries is a defense technology company with a mission to transform U.S. and allied military capabilities with advanced technology. By bringing the expertise, technology, and business model of the 21st century’s most innovative companies to the defense industry, Anduril is changing how military systems are designed, built and sold. Anduril’s...
-
Senior Software Development Engineer
1 month ago
Sydney, New South Wales, Australia NICE Full timeJob OverviewNICE is a leading company in the field of software development. We are currently seeking a highly skilled Senior Software Development Engineer to join our team.Salary and BenefitsThe estimated salary for this position is $120,000 - $180,000 per year, depending on experience. The company offers a competitive benefits package, including health...
-
Senior Software Engineer-Java
5 months ago
Sydney, Australia Virtusa Full timeSenior Software Engineer-Java - 132416 Description Designing Java-based applications and their full implementation. Good experience in CI/CD, Devops Software engineer with Fixed income experience Understanding the requirements of the users to create the application design. Defining the objectives and functions of the applications. Ensuring that...
-
Senior Cloud Software Engineer
2 months ago
Sydney, New South Wales, Australia Firesoft People Full timeFullstack Software EngineerFiresoft People is seeking a skilled Senior Cloud Software Engineer with expertise in React, Node, and Typescript development to join the team.Key Responsibilities:Develop modern web applications using React, Node, and Typescript.Design and implement scalable microservice infrastructure.Collaborate with the software team to ensure...
-
Senior Software Engineer
1 month ago
Sydney, New South Wales, Australia HCF Australia Full timeJob OverviewHCF Australia is a leading healthcare provider seeking an experienced Senior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ining software applications that meet the needs of our members.SalaryWe offer a competitive salary package ranging from $120,000 to...
-
Senior Software Engineer
2 months ago
Sydney, New South Wales, Australia The Benevolent Society Full timeAbout the Role: We are seeking a highly skilled Senior Software Engineer to join our team at {company}.The ideal candidate will have a solid understanding of software development principles and be able to design, develop, and maintain high-quality software solutions.Evaluate and prioritize project requirements to ensure timely deliveryDevelop and implement...
-
Senior Software Engineering Professional
4 weeks ago
Sydney, New South Wales, Australia WiseTech Global Full timeWe're seeking Senior Software Engineering Professionals to join our development teams in Australia. In this role, you'll be pivotal in designing, building, and maintaining products and platform services that power global logistics.About the Role:We value your coding skills, regardless of whether you specialize in C#.NET or other programming languages. We...
-
Senior Software Engineering Team Lead
1 month ago
Sydney, New South Wales, Australia Cuscal Full timeJob SummaryWe are seeking a highly experienced Senior Software Engineering Team Lead to join our team at Cuscal. In this role, you will provide technical leadership and direction to our engineering teams, ensuring the delivery of high-quality software solutions that meet business and customer needs.About the RoleThe Senior Software Engineering Team Lead will...
-
Software Engineer Senior Leader
1 month ago
Sydney, New South Wales, Australia Jobs for Humanity Full timeJob Title: Software Engineer Senior LeaderSalary: AU$120,000 - AU$180,000 per annum, depending on experience.About the Role:We are seeking an experienced Software Engineer Senior Leader to join our team in Sydney. As a key member of our agile development team, you will play a critical role in designing, building, implementing, and testing high-quality...
-
Senior Software Engineer Opportunity
4 weeks ago
Sydney, New South Wales, Australia EBR Full timeCompany Overview: Our client, a leading supplier of furnishing fabrics, is seeking a Senior Software Engineer to join their team based in Sydney.Salary: This full-time role offers a generous performance-based wage rise, with an estimated salary of AU$120,000 - AU$180,000 per annum, depending on experience.Job Description:We are looking for a passionate and...
-
Senior Software Engineering Leader
4 weeks ago
Sydney, New South Wales, Australia Westpac Group Full timeWelcome to an exciting opportunity at Westpac Group, a leading financial institution with a rich history spanning over 200 years.We're seeking a talented Senior Full Stack Software Developer to join our vibrant technology community. As a key member of our team, you'll play a significant part in shaping the future of our business and delivering innovative...
-
Senior Software Engineering Leader
1 month ago
Sydney, New South Wales, Australia Nuix Full timeAbout the RoleWe're seeking a Senior Software Engineering Leader to join our team at Nuix. As a key member of our engineering leadership, you will play a critical role in shaping the future of our software and driving innovation.Job Description:Lead Technical Vision: Collaborate with cross-functional teams to drive technical vision and strategy for our...
-
Senior Software Engineering Lead
1 month ago
Sydney, New South Wales, Australia Luxury Escapes Full timeJob DescriptionWe are seeking an experienced Senior Software Engineering Lead to join our team at Luxury Escapes. In this role, you will be responsible for managing a team of software engineers, overseeing the development and delivery of software solutions, and ensuring that our technology infrastructure meets the needs of our business.Luxury Escapes is one...